- In this episode of Stop Requested, Levi McCollum and Christian Londono talk with Frank White III, former CEO of the Kansas City Area Transportation Authority and founder and managing partner of Praxis Advisors Group. Frank reflects on leading KCATA through workforce shortages, funding pressures, regional coordination, and the return of fares after years of fare-free service.
The conversation explores why transit leaders have to get the basics right before pursuing bigger ambitions, how data and transparency can help navigate difficult decisions, and why transit agencies should have a seat at the table in economic development and regional planning. Anthony shares how his work in operations research and the MARTA Reach pilot led to building an AI-powered platform for transit planning.
The conversation explores how agencies can test thousands of network scenarios, uncover unmet demand, and weigh tradeoffs between ridership, coverage, cost, and equity. Shofi shares how the agency uses community feedback, rider data, and operational experience to shape service decisions.
The conversation explores Cherriots’ ridership growth, 90 percent on-time performance, and plans for microtransit, bike share, and new transit centers. - In this episode of Stop Requested, Levi McCollum and Christian Londono talk with Coree Cuff Lonergan, CEO and General Manager of Broward County Transit. Coree shares how Broward is building on its bus network through TransitFORWARD 2040 and PREMO, the county’s long-term effort to create a more connected, multimodal transit system.
The conversation explores Broward County’s plans for bus rapid transit, commuter rail, light rail, high-frequency bus service, and stronger connections between the airport, seaport, convention center, and surrounding communities. Coree also discusses community engagement, listening sessions, program delivery, eliminating transit deserts, and BCT’s role in supporting regional travel during the World Cup.

About Stop Requested
Stop Requested is a podcast hosted by Christian Londono and Levi McCollum, where they explore all things transit—from public transportation trends and innovations to the daily experiences of riders and transit professionals. Join them for insightful discussions, industry interviews, and a behind-the-scenes look at the challenges and successes shaping the future of mobility.
